The Camden County Department of Health is announcing 678 new positive cases of COVID-19 and 9 new deaths which occurred between Saturday, October 16, and Friday, October 22nd. One hundred seventy-eight (178) are

among patients under 18 years old. Seven (7) new cases were identified in Merchantville. The average age of the newly infected is 35.7 years old. Current NJ Dashboard data as of 10/20/2021 shows Merchantville residents improving on their vaccination status since 3 weeks ago. Residents who have received at least one dose age 12 and over increased from 85% to 87%; age 18 and over increased from 81% to 83%; age 30 and over went from 82% to 84%; and, age 65 and over from 97% to 100%. Merchantville's completed dose rate for age 12 and over improved from 81% to 82%; age 18 and over went from 76% to 78%; age 30 and over increased from 76% to 78% ; and, age 65 and over grew from 93% to 94%.
